There is no news that Chennai is considered the capital of India's diabetes. With the number of diabetics is increasing every year, this condition began to affect children.
Diabetes mellitus is a metabolic disorder in the endocrine system. This terrible disease is found in all parts of the world and is becoming a serious threat for humanity.
There are many chemicals available to control and treat diabetic patients, but the total recovery diabetes has not been reported until now. In addition to side effects, drug treatments are not always adequate to maintain normal blood sugar levels and prevent diabetes complications at an advanced stage. Dietary supplements
Vitamins and minerals are micronutrients that our body needs in small amounts to specific function. According to Dr. Rajat, "They work mostly as an essential co-enzyme and cofactor metabolic reaction and thus help support basic cellular reactions. Micronutrients were studied as prevention and possible treatment agents for type diabetes 1 and Type 2 and common complication of diabetes. " Minerals such as chromium, vanadium, magnesium, nicotinamide and vitamin E are essential for optimum health and low levels of these minerals and vitamins are associated with a higher incidence of diabetes. Consulting a specialist with minerals and vitamins to take, and its quantity can help a diabetic patient.
Hydrotherapy
Hydrotherapy is the treatment of diseases and injuries through the use of water, both hot and cold. Hydrotherapy helps the body get rid of toxins and relax muscles. It also relaxes the body, both physically and mentally. Since the spa therapy can increase blood flow to skeletal muscle, it was recommended for patients with type 2 diabetes who are unable to exercise.
According to Dr. Kanika Selva, a hydrotherapist, "It has been shown by various studies and experiments in hot water, the weight of a patient, the mean level of glucose in the plasma and its average glycated hemoglobin decreases." She points out, "Hot tub therapy has yet to be evaluated as a therapy for patients with diabetes mellitus type 2. The benefit could result from the increased blood flow to skeletal muscle.

Acupuncture
Acupuncture therapy is a common approach for the treatment of diabetes in China. He is best known in the US as an alternative therapy for chronic pain. However, it has been used for the treatment of diabetes and complications in the past decades. Acupuncture can be effective in treating not only diabetes but also in the prevention and management of complications of the disease. However, acupuncture showed some effect in the treatment of diabetes, its mechanism of action is still obscure.
